CWA Charleston: April 29-30, 2016


Broad Street - Charleston_ South Carolina
 
 

The Mary Martin Gallery in Charleston is presenting an exhibition of wood art by our friends and colleagues Andy DiPietro, Ashley Harwood, Christian Burchard, Cindy Drozda, Cynthia Gibson, David Ellsworth, Derek Weidman, Dixie Biggs, John Beaver, Keith Holt, Marilyn Campbell, Stephen Hatcher, and Warren Carpenter.

In addition to a representative selection of their newest work, there will be one piece in the exhibit by each artist that responds to and interprets the tragic event at the Mother Emanuel AME Church, and the response of the city and state to the deaths of nine pastors and parishioners at the hands of a racially-inspired gunman. 

In conjunction with this exhibition, Richard Hogue has planned an exciting weekend of activities for the Collectors of Wood Art and the artists.

CWA Charleston begins with lunch at noon on Friday, April 29, in the Drawing Room at the Vendue Inn and concludes after dinner on Saturday, April 30, at the home of Richard and Elizabeth Hogue. Included in the program are the following:

  • Two lunches and two dinners
  • Guided tours of the Halsey Institute of Contemporary Art, the Nathaniel Russell House, the French Quarter (galleries, churches and points of interest), Middleton Place Gardensand Plantation Grounds, two artist studios, and the City Gallery a Waterfront Park
  • Lecture and demonstration on sweetgrass basket making
  • Private reception and exhibition opening
  • Bus tour of the lower peninsula and/or Patriot's Point
